182. Deputy Michael McGrath asked the Minister for Finance his views of what constitutes conditions of financial stability in respect of the timetable for the sale by the Central Bank of Ireland of Irish Government bonds it has acquired as a result of the revised promissory note; and if he will make a statement on the matter. [9590/13]
